在区块链网络中,"待处理交易(Pending Transactions)"如同高速公路上的"瞬时车流"——它们已被节点接收、验证并打包进候选区块,但尚未通过共识机制确认上链,长期以来,大多数普通用户和开发者更关注已确认的区块数据,而以太坊近期对"Pending同步"功能的重点优化,正悄然重塑网络交互的实时性边界,为DeFi、NFT等高频应用注入新活力。
传统同步模式下,节点优先下载已确认的区块数据(从创世块到最新区块),而Pending交易则作为临时数据存储在内存池(mempool)中,仅在新区块产生时被短暂处理,这种模式导致两个核心问题:一是用户无法实时感知交易在网络中的确切状态(如是否被矿工优先打包、手续费调整是否生效);二是开发者构建的高频应用(如DEX套利机器人、NFT秒杀系统)需依赖第三方API获取Pending数据,增加信任成本与延迟。
以太坊通过升级客户端软件(如Geth、Nethermind),正式将Pending同步纳入标准同步流程,节点在同步历史区块的同时,会主动订阅mempool中的交易更新,并实时向应用层广播Pending状态变化,这意味着,开发者可直接通过节点API获取"交易已进入mempool""被矿工纳入候选区块"等实时事件,无需再依赖外部中间件。

Pending同步的普及,首先降低了用户体验的不确定性,以以太坊上的转账为例:用户提交交易后,节点即可实时反馈该交易是否因手续费不足被暂时搁置,或是否因网络拥堵被多个矿工竞争,这种"事中透明"避免了传统模式下"交易提交后如同石沉大海"的焦虑,让用户能动态调整策略(如提高Gas费加速)。
对高频应用而言,Pending同步更是"效率革命",以DeFi套利机器人为例,其核心逻辑是捕捉不同DEX间的价差并快速执行交易,过去,机器人需通过第三方API获取Pending数据,存在0.5-2秒的延迟,易因"数据滞后"错失最佳套利窗口,直接同步节点Pending数据可将延迟降至毫秒级,同时减少对第三方服务的依赖,降低被"前端运行"(Front-running)的风险。
尽管Pending同步带来显著价值,但其实现仍面临技术挑战,Pending数据的高实时性要求节点具备更强的内存处理能力——以太坊主网每日处理的Pending交易可达数百万笔,节点需高效过滤、验证并广播这些数据,对硬件性能提出更高要求,如何平衡数据"实时性"与"隐私性"成为新课题:部分Pending交易包含敏感信息(如大额转账),节点需在实时广播的同时,支持数据加密或选择性披露,避免用户隐私泄露。
随着以太坊"合并"后向PoS的完全过渡,以及Proto-Danksharding(EIP-4844)等扩容方案的落地,Pending同步的效率还将进一步提升,PoS机制下,验证节点可直接参与交易排序,减少对矿工的依赖;而分片技术将分担网络负载,降低Pending数据的处理压力,这些迭代将共同推动以太坊从"区块确认的互联网"向"实时交互的价值网络"演进。
从"等待确认"到"实时感知",以太坊开启Pending同步不仅是技术功能的优化,更是对区块链交互范式的革新,它让网络更贴近"实时金融系统"的本质,为构建更高效、更透明的Web3应用奠定了基石,随着生态的持续进化,Pending同步或将成为衡量区块链网络"实时性能"的新标准,引领行业迈向更低延迟、更高确定性的未来。